Was Vehicle Towed: - Description of the Complaints: Consumer took car to a car wash when control box got wet, then the fuel injector froze open, causing fuel to leak onto the engine. car spilled gasoline all over the ground. consumer was trying to start vehicle when the car when a car wash attendant came out and told her not to start vehicle because it might blow up. prior cars of 1994 bmw had this same problem. *ak
